Funciones de API de colaboración

La infraestructura de colaboración del mismo nivel admite las siguientes funciones.

Función Descripción
PeerCollabAddContact Agrega un contacto a la lista de contactos de un mismo nivel.
PeerCollabAsyncInviteContact Envía una invitación a un contacto del mismo nivel de confianza para unirse a la actividad de colaboración del mismo nivel del remitente a través de una conexión segura.
PeerCollabAsyncInviteEndpoint Envía una invitación a un punto de conexión del mismo nivel especificado para unirse a la actividad de colaboración del mismo nivel del remitente. La disponibilidad de la respuesta a la invitación se actualiza a través de un evento asincrónico.
PeerCollabCancelInvitation Cancela una invitación enviada previamente por el autor de la llamada a un contacto.
PeerCollabCloseHandle Cierra el identificador de una invitación de actividad de colaboración del mismo nivel.
PeerCollabDeleteContact Elimina un contacto del mismo nivel actual.
PeerCollabDeleteEndpointData Elimina los datos del punto de conexión del mismo nivel en el nodo del mismo nivel que coincide con los datos del punto de conexión proporcionados.
PeerCollabDeleteObject Elimina un objeto del mismo nivel del punto de conexión que llama.
PeerCollabEnumApplications Devuelve el identificador a una enumeración que contiene las funcionalidades registradas en los puntos de conexión del mismo nivel específicos.
PeerCollabEnumApplicationRegistrationInfo Obtiene el identificador de enumeración usado para recuperar información de la aplicación del mismo nivel.
PeerCollabEnumContacts Devuelve un identificador a un conjunto enumerado que contiene todos los contactos de red de colaboración del mismo nivel disponibles actualmente en el elemento del mismo nivel que realiza la llamada.
PeerCollabEnumEndpoints Devuelve el identificador a una enumeración que contiene los puntos de conexión asociados a un contacto del mismo nivel específico.
PeerCollabEnumObjects Devuelve el identificador a una enumeración que contiene los objetos del mismo nivel asociados a un punto de conexión específico del mismo nivel.
PeerCollabEnumPeopleNearMe Devuelve un identificador a un conjunto enumerado que contiene todos los puntos de conexión de red de colaboración del mismo nivel "personas cerca de mí" disponibles actualmente en la subred del mismo nivel que realiza la llamada.
PeerCollabExportContact Exporta los datos de contacto asociados a un nombre del mismo nivel a un búfer de cadena de datos XML de contacto.
PeerCollabGetAppLaunchInfo Obtiene la información de inicio de la aplicación del mismo nivel, incluido el nombre del contacto, el punto de conexión del mismo nivel y la solicitud de invitación.
PeerCollabGetApplicationRegistrationInfo Obtiene información de registro de aplicación específica.
PeerCollabGetContact Obtiene la información de un contacto del mismo nivel específico según el nombre del mismo nivel del contacto.
PeerCollabGetEndpointName Recupera el nombre del punto de conexión actual del mismo nivel de llamada establecido previamente por una llamada a PeerCollabSetEndpointName.
PeerCollabGetEventData Obtiene los datos asociados a un evento de colaboración del mismo nivel generado en el mismo nivel.
PeerCollabGetInvitationResponse Obtiene la respuesta del mismo nivel previamente invitado a unirse a una actividad de colaboración del mismo nivel.
PeerCollabGetPresenceInfo Recupera la información de presencia del punto de conexión asociado a un contacto específico.
PeerCollabGetSigninOptions Obtiene las opciones actuales de presencia de red de colaboración del mismo nivel que ha iniciado sesión.
PeerCollabInviteContact Envía una invitación para unirse a una actividad de colaboración del mismo nivel a un contacto de confianza. Esta llamada es sincrónica y, si se ejecuta correctamente, obtiene una respuesta del contacto.
PeerCollabInviteEndpoint Envía una invitación a un punto de conexión del mismo nivel especificado para unirse a la actividad de colaboración del mismo nivel del remitente. Esta llamada es sincrónica y, si se ejecuta correctamente, obtiene una respuesta del punto de conexión del mismo nivel.
PeerCollabParseContact Analiza un búfer de cadenas Unicode que contiene datos XML de contacto en una estructura de datos PEER_CONTACT .
PeerCollabQueryContactData Recupera la información de contacto del punto de conexión del mismo nivel proporcionado.
PeerCollabRefreshEndpointData Novedades el nodo del mismo nivel que llama con nuevos datos de punto de conexión.
PeerCollabRegisterApplication Registra una aplicación con el equipo local para que se pueda iniciar en una actividad de colaboración del mismo nivel.
PeerCollabRegisterEvent Registra una aplicación con la infraestructura de colaboración del mismo nivel para recibir devoluciones de llamada para eventos específicos de colaboración del mismo nivel.
PeerCollabSetEndpointName Establece el nombre del punto de conexión actual usado por la aplicación del mismo nivel.
PeerCollabSetObject Crea o actualiza un objeto de datos del mismo nivel que se usa en una red de colaboración del mismo nivel.
PeerCollabSetPresenceInfo Novedades la información de presencia del autor de la llamada a cualquier contacto que la vea.
PeerCollabSignIn Firma el par en un proveedor de presencia de red de colaboración del mismo nivel (presencia sin servidor) o subred ("Personas Cerca de mí").
PeerCollabSignOut Firma un elemento del mismo nivel fuera de un tipo específico de proveedor de presencia de red de colaboración del mismo nivel.
PeerCollabShutdown Cierra la infraestructura de colaboración del mismo nivel y libera los recursos asociados a él.
PeerCollabStartup Inicializa la infraestructura de colaboración del mismo nivel.
PeerCollabSubscribeEndpointData Crea una suscripción a un punto de conexión disponible.
PeerCollabUnregisterApplication Anula el registro de las aplicaciones específicas de un elemento del mismo nivel del equipo local.
PeerCollabUnregisterEvent Anula el registro de una aplicación a partir de una notificación sobre eventos específicos de colaboración del mismo nivel.
PeerCollabUnsubscribeEndpointData Quita una suscripción a un punto de conexión creado con PeerCollabSubscribeEndpointData.
PeerCollabUpdateContact Novedades un elemento del mismo nivel que participa en una red de colaboración del mismo nivel con nueva información sobre un contacto del mismo nivel.